Rustup, the widely adopted command-line utility for managing Rust toolchains, has reached a significant milestone with the release of version 1.28.0. This update streamlines its behavior, broadens platform compatibility, and supports Rust’s evolving ecosystem. Rustup continues to play a crucial role in enhancing the Rust toolchain experience, particularly for developers working across multiple systems and environments.
Version 1.28.0 also coincides with a visual overhaul of the official Rust website, introducing modern design elements and a more precise brand alignment. Together, these updates refine both the onboarding process for new Rust users and the development experience for existing ones.
One of the most noticeable changes in Rustup 1.28.0 is the more explicit toolchain installation behavior. Previously, if a toolchain was referenced but not installed, Rustup would automatically retrieve and install it. While convenient, this sometimes led to ambiguity, especially in automated environments.
Now, starting with version 1.28.0, Rustup requires users to explicitly install the desired version if the active toolchain is missing. This change gives developers more control over their development environments, ensuring installations are intentional and clearly defined. This adjustment aligns Rustup’s behavior more closely with practices expected in production environments, where predictability and reproducibility are critical.
Rust’s growing popularity across diverse hardware and operating systems has driven consistent platform expansion. With version 1.28.0, Rustup adds official support for new host targets, including:
These additions ensure that Rust remains accessible on both established and emerging architectures. Support for AArch64 (64-bit ARM) on Windows is crucial as ARM-based devices gain adoption. Similarly, adding LoongArch64 on Linux reflects a commitment to global architecture support, enabling developers to work natively on preferred platforms without relying on cross-compilation.
The rustup show
command, frequently used to report the current Rust toolchain and configuration state, has been refined in version 1.28.0. The output is now cleaner and more user-friendly, presenting the active toolchain and components in a structured format. This enhancement improves readability, particularly in terminal sessions or CI environments where understanding the toolchain state quickly is crucial.
Rustup 1.28.0 enhances navigation for the rustup doc
command, which opens local or online documentation for Rust components. The improved navigation makes it easier for users to quickly access the content they need. Additionally, new aliases for the rustup remove
command provide more intuitive shorthand options for managing installed toolchains, lowering the entry barrier for new users.
Alongside Rustup 1.28.0, the official Rust website has undergone a comprehensive redesign, aligning its visual identity with the broader Rust brand. The new design features consistent typography, layout choices, and visual hierarchy while offering a more modern, responsive layout for easier navigation across devices. This refresh emphasizes accessibility, clarity, and professionalism, reinforcing confidence in Rust as a stable, production-ready language.
A key theme in Rustup 1.28.0 is a commitment to developer autonomy and precision. By making toolchain installation behavior explicit, expanding platform compatibility, and improving system state visibility, the update ensures developers have complete control over their environments. Rustup reflects Rust’s philosophy of correctness and safety by refining behavior to support transparency and intention-driven workflows.
Rustup 1.28.0 demonstrates that meaningful progress comes through thoughtful adjustments—better defaults, cleaner outputs, smarter behavior, and broader compatibility. With improved command output, expanded platform support, and a redesigned website, this update underscores Rust’s maturation as both a language and a community. Rustup remains a cornerstone of the Rust toolchain, with version 1.28.0 reinforcing its importance through enhancements that developers will notice every day.
NinjaOne, Freshservice, N-central, Automox, Zoho Sprints, Uniqkey, Datto RMM, and Atera are the best IT management software
Learn how to add a private messaging plugin to WordPress for better user engagement, security, and real-time communication.
Explore Zoho Desk, Zendesk, Freshdesk, Jira Service Desk, HappyFox, and Kustomer as the most affordable help desk software solutions to streamline your customer support.
Discover the top seven alternatives to Microsoft Project, including Smartsheet, ClickUp, Wrike, Monday.com, Zoho Projects, Asana, and Trello, to enhance your workflow.
Discover how to follow up with customers anywhere using respond.io to centralize messages, automate workflows, and boost engagement across channels.
Compare Google Meet and Zoom to discover which video conferencing platform fits your needs best in 2025.
Discover how to streamline your customer journey using Teamleader Focus with these 5 practical, easy-to-apply strategies.
Upgrade your chat support with Social Intents. Help customers faster, boost satisfaction, and grow your business easily.
Discover the best email marketing tool for your business by comparing Brevo and Mailchimp based on features, pricing, and automation.
Discover omnichannel marketing, which provides customers with a seamless journey across all touchpoints while enhancing business performance.
Discover the best HubSpot alternatives for startups, focusing on affordable CRM, marketing automation, and sales technologies.
Discover six powerful session replay tools in 2025 to enhance user experience and boost conversions by observing real-time user interactions.